Major Setback for VIP: National Vice President Badri Purvey Resigns, Speculation Rises Over His Possible Move to BJP

Darbhanga (Bihar): Political circles in Bihar are abuzz after Vikassheel Insaan Party (VIP) chief Mukesh Sahani faced a major setback on Sunday with the resignation of the party’s National Vice President, Badri Purvey. He announced his decision publicly through social media, triggering intense speculation about his next political move.

In his Facebook post, Purvey wrote, “I am resigning from all responsibilities in the party. This decision has been taken after due consideration of the organizational circumstances.”

Though he refrained from making any statement about his future plans, his recent meeting with NDA candidate and Bihar minister Sanjay Saraogi in Darbhanga has fueled speculation that he may soon join the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P).

Political analysts believe Purvey’s exit from VIP may not be a mere personal decision but part of a broader political strategy. If he joins the BJP, it could help the NDA strengthen its social and electoral base in Darbhanga and nearby regions.

VIP chief Mukesh Sahani has not yet issued an official response to the development, but Purvey’s resignation has certainly raised questions about the party’s internal stability.
